Alex Forbes was instructed by the applicant local authority, Andrew Leong was instructed by Duncan Lewis solicitors for the father, Stephen Crispin was instructed by Oxford Law Group for children N, O & P and John Vater KC, leading Oliver Powell, was instructed by Reeds for child L in L, M, N, O and P, Re (allegation of sexual abuse by a sibling) [2025] EWFC 382 (B); a fact-finding concerning allegations of sexual abuse made by a child against a sibling.
This case concerned a 9-year-old girl, N, who told her teachers she thought she had been raped while asleep, though she was unsure whether it was real or a dream. She mentioned two incidents but could not identify a perpetrator. The police investigated the father and older brothers and found no evidence of abuse. N was placed in foster care while the local authority pursued Family Court proceedings due to ongoing concerns. After hearing extensive evidence from teachers, foster carers, social workers, police interviews and medical reports, the Court found N had not been raped and likely misinterpreted a dream. The judge found the parents protective, criticised aspects of the local authority’s approach, and ordered N’s safe return home.
